Frequently Asked Questions about San Mateo

How much are Studio apartments in San Mateo?

There are currently 829 Studio Apartments in San Mateo with rent ranges from $1,850 to $3,947 with an average price of $2,735.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om San Mateo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in San Mateo ranges from $2,095 to $8,861 with an average monthly rent of $3,534.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in San Mateo c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in San Mateo range from $2,650 to $11,610.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,510.

How expensive are San Mateo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 218 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in San Mateo on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,795 to $12,990 - averaging $5,890 for the location.
